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Module › Views ›

[gelöst] drupal 7 wie sinnvoll "where" Bedingung in Views einbauen

Eingetragen von Tomson (9)
am 13.09.2013 - 11:00 Uhr in
  • Views
  • Drupal 7.x

Hallo,

Ausgangssituation:
ich habe zwei Content-Types "CT" mit diversen Feldern. CT(A).field1 ist vom Typ Date und CT(B).field1 ist vom Typ Date.

Ich möchte folgendes in einer Reihe anzeigen lassen

select CT(A).field1,CT(A).field2, CT(A).field3, CT(B).field2
where CT(A).field1 = CT(B).field1

Aktuell werden CT(A)(fields) und CT(B).field2 in unterschiedlichen Reihen angezeigt.

Ich verwende entity reference, kann die beiden CT aber nicht sinnvoll referenzieren. Da sie ansonsten unabhängig voneinander sind.
Ich benötige die obige where Klausel also nur für den view und die gewünschte Information.

Wo und wie kann ich die "where"-Klausel elegant einbauen

Lässt sich das innerhalb Views mit Bordmitteln zusammen clicken?
Kann ich eventuell irgendwo Token verwenden ?
Brauche ich ein Zusatzmodul wie Node Reference?
Oder muss ich das über einen Hook lösen? ungern - da ich bis jetzt ohne Hooks ziemlich weit gekommen bin und es simpel halten will...

Danke für jeden Tip
Tom

‹ [gelöst] Views block nur auf der Startseite, welchen Filter muss ich setzen? [gelöst] drupal 7 wie sinnvoll "where" Bedingung in Views einbauen 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Tomson schrieb Lässt sich das

Eingetragen von glycid (921)
am 13.09.2013 - 11:43 Uhr
Tomson schrieb

Lässt sich das innerhalb Views mit Bordmitteln zusammen clicken?

Mit dem Zusatzmodul https://drupal.org/project/views_custom_conditions hab ich ähnliches schon "zusammenklicken" können.

  • Anmelden oder Registrieren um Kommentare zu schreiben

@glycid

Eingetragen von Tomson (9)
am 13.09.2013 - 12:34 Uhr

Danke glycid,
lustig.... habe mir eben vor deiner Antwort schon views_custom_conditions angesehen und spiele seitdem damit rum
Der Weg scheint vielversprechend..

Gerade kämpfe ich allerdings mit der Syntax und bekomme ständig SQL Fehler angezeigt.
...ist ja nicht sonderlich gut dokumentiert. (Keine echten beispiele)

Falls Du ein Codesnippet zur Hand hast was Du wie in dieSetbox einfügst, wär das unheimlich hilfreich.

LG
Tom

  • Anmelden oder Registrieren um Kommentare zu schreiben

Tomson schrieb Falls Du ein

Eingetragen von glycid (921)
am 13.09.2013 - 15:56 Uhr
Tomson schrieb

Falls Du ein Codesnippet zur Hand hast was Du wie in dieSetbox einfügst, wär das unheimlich hilfreich.

Hab ich leider nicht mehr. Das war ein ewiges Gefrickel und keine große Hilfe, wenn man mit mehreren Tabellen arbeiten muss. Irgendwie hatte ich es dann zwar hingewurschtelt, so dass es funktionierte, aber überzeugt hat mich das nicht. Deshalb hab ich's wieder rausgeschmissen und den Query von Hand gebaut. Würde ich Dir auch empfehlen, geht einfach viel schneller.

  • Anmelden oder Registrieren um Kommentare zu schreiben

trotzdem Danke

Eingetragen von Tomson (9)
am 13.09.2013 - 22:44 Uhr

trotzdem Danke fürs Feedback.
LG
Tom

  • Anmelden oder Registrieren um Kommentare zu schreiben

nur so aus Neugier: Hast Du

Eingetragen von glycid (921)
am 16.09.2013 - 14:00 Uhr

nur so aus Neugier: Hast Du es jetzt per Modul oder von Hand gelöst?

  • Anmelden oder Registrieren um Kommentare zu schreiben

nein ...

Eingetragen von Tomson (9)
am 16.09.2013 - 17:46 Uhr

nein ich habe einen komplett anderen Ansatz gesucht und gefunden..
..ein einziger ziemlich komplexer Content-Type mit diversen field-collections
und diese wiederum via field_group und horizontal tabs in form gebracht.
Kann ich jetzt gut mit leben ...

lg tom

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 2 Wochen 1 Tag
  • Hey danke
    vor 2 Wochen 1 Tag
  • Update: jetzt gibt's ein
    vor 2 Wochen 2 Tagen
  • Hallo, im Prinzip habe ich
    vor 3 Wochen 1 Stunde
  • Da scheint die Terminologie
    vor 3 Wochen 4 Stunden
  • Kannst doch auch alles direkt
    vor 3 Wochen 4 Tagen
  • In der entsprechenden View
    vor 3 Wochen 4 Tagen
  • Dazu müsstest Du vermutlich
    vor 3 Wochen 4 Tagen
  • gelöst
    vor 6 Wochen 1 Tag
  • Ja natürlich. Dass ist etwas,
    vor 6 Wochen 1 Tag

Statistik

Beiträge im Forum: 250233
Registrierte User: 20453

Neue User:

  • ByteScrapers
  • Mroppoofpaync
  • 4aficiona2

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 34 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association